如何在Java中从JTextField向JTable添加和更新行以及删除行

如何在Java中从JTextField向JTable添加和更新行以及删除行,java,swing,Java,Swing,我最近刚到这个网站。我在Java中从JTextField+Delete Row向JTable添加和更新行时遇到问题,请您帮助我并给出源代码,这一切取决于您如何实现表、使用了哪些列、显示了什么 通常在表模型中添加行或从表模型中删除行。 下面是一个使用DefaultTableModel的非常基本(不完整)的示例: private JTable table; private DefaultTableModel model; private void init() { model = new

我最近刚到这个网站。我在Java中从JTextField+Delete Row向JTable添加和更新行时遇到问题,请您帮助我并给出源代码,这一切取决于您如何实现表、使用了哪些列、显示了什么

通常在表模型中添加行或从表模型中删除行。 下面是一个使用DefaultTableModel的非常基本(不完整)的示例:

private JTable table;
private DefaultTableModel model;

private void init() {
    model = new DefaultTableModel(...);
    table = new JTable(model);
    ...
}

private void addRow(String[] rowValues) {
    model.addRow(rowValues);
}

private void remRow(int rowIndex) {
    model.removeRow(rowIndex);
}

通常,建议为显示的数据创建特定的TableModel。请参阅本教程。

您必须描述问题。“提供源代码”雇用人员。这是一个问答网站,不是代码生成机器。请阅读
DefaultTableModel
API。有添加/删除数据行的方法。